Как сделать на Kindle погоды домашний информер

Как сделать на Kindle погоды домашний информер

26 Фев 2026 | Автор: | Комментарии к записи Как сделать на Kindle погоды домашний информер отключены

Первым шагом к реализации информативного модуля о погодных условиях на вашем устройстве станет выбор платформы для получения данных. Рекомендуется использовать API, такие как OpenWeatherMap или WeatherAPI, которые предоставляют актуальную информацию о погоде. Регистрация на их сайтах даст доступ к необходимым ключам для работы с данными.

Далее, потребуется использовать язык программирования, который поддерживает взаимодействие с API и отображение информации. Python подходит для этой цели благодаря своей простоте и большому количеству библиотек. В частности, библиотека requests упростит процесс получения информации из выбранного API, а библиотека tkinter – создание графического интерфейса.

Последним этапом будет создание пользовательского интерфейса, который позволит отображать актуальные данные о погоде. Здесь стоит сосредоточиться на удобстве и понятности навигации, чтобы любой мог быстро получить информацию. Не забудьте настроить периодическую автоматическую загрузку данных, чтобы информация всегда оставалась актуальной.

Технические требования для создания информера на Kindle

Необходима совместимость с форматом MOBI или AZW, так как именно они поддерживаются устройствами. Для этого используйте инструменты, такие как Calibre, для конвертации информации.

Важна оптимизация изображения под размеры экрана устройства. Рекомендуется использовать разрешение 600x800 пикселей для обеспечения качественного отображения.

Размер файла не должен превышать 50 МБ, чтобы предотвратить проблемы с загрузкой и отображением. Убедитесь, что другие аспекты информации также соответствуют ограничениям по объему файла.

Необходимо внедрить систему автоматического обновления данных для поддержания актуальности информации. Используйте API для извлечения данных в реальном времени.

Вариант контента должен быть адаптирован к формату рендера на устройстве. Используйте XHTML и CSS для задания стилей и разметки.

Оптимизируйте текст, чтобы сохранить читаемость и избежать сложных элементов, которые могут мешать восприятию информации.

Корректность и точность данных важны для повышения доверия пользователей. Обеспечьте проверку источников информации перед публикацией.

Выбор источника данных о погоде для информера

Рекомендуется рассмотреть API таких сервисов, как OpenWeatherMap или WeatherAPI, которые предоставляют актуальную информацию о климатических условиях и имеют широкие возможности интеграции. OpenWeatherMap предлагает стабильный бесплатный тарифный план с ограничением на количество запросов, а также различные параметры, включая прогноза на несколько дней. WeatherAPI отличается простотой работы и наличием históricos метеоданных. Принять во внимание следует и такие ресурсы, как Climacell и AccuWeather, обладающие высоким уровнем точности данных, но чаще требуют платной подписки для доступа к полному функционалу.

Перед выбором, стоит протестировать разные источники, обращая внимание на качество и скорость обновления информации. Убедитесь, что выбранный сервис поддерживает необходимые форматы данных, такие как JSON или XML, что облегчит обработку и отображение информации. Некоторые API также предоставляют графическое отображение данных, что может упростить задачу интеграции.

Проверьте наличие документации, которая поможет разобраться с функционалом и настройками. Обратите внимание на легкость регистрации и наличие поддержки пользователей, что может быть полезным на начальном этапе работы. Сравните доступные функции, такие как возможность получения данных о качестве воздуха, уровне осадков, скорости ветра и температурных колебаний.

Не менее важной станет оценка лимитов на количество запросов и условий использования. Следите за обновлениями API, так как иногда изменяются правила или тарифы. При правильном выборе источника можно добиться высокой точности данных и удобства в использовании.

Шаги по настройке кода и отображению информации на Kindle

Соберите необходимые библиотеки для работы с API погоды, например, OpenWeatherMap. Зарегистрируйтесь на сайте и получите ключ доступа.

Создайте файл с расширением .py и начните с импорта нужных модулей. Подключите библиотеку для отправки HTTP-запросов, такую как requests.

Запишите функцию для получения данных о метеорологической информации. Используйте ваш API-ключ и составьте URL-адрес запроса с указанием города, для которого нужна информация.

Обработайте полученные данные. Извлеките необходимые параметры, такие как температура, влажность, и условия погоды. Эти значения можно отформатировать для удобного отображения.

Запланируйте периодическую проверку обновлений погоды. Используйте библиотеку для установки таймера, чтобы информация обновлялась автоматически через заданные интервалы времени.

Тестируйте код. Убедитесь, что информация отображается корректно. Если возникнут ошибки, выполните отладку. Проводите корректировки, если потребуется.

Загрузите получившийся файл на устройство читалки. Убедитесь, что все функции работают должным образом после передачи на устройство.

Другие статьи категории "Разное":
Наши партнеры

Найдите в админке сайта панель Directory News - Настройки, блок Нижний блок - Виджеты социальных сетей

Добавьте в него виджет Твиттера или виджет вашей группы в любой из социальных сетей.

Как создать виджет Твиттера, написано здесь.

Новости

Самый лучший хостинг для ваших сайтов

Читать нас
Связаться с нами
Наши контакты

О сайте

Женский журнал - Женские хитрости красоты и здоровья